ABSTRACT
The broad-spectrum antiviral Remdesivir, a monophosphate nucleoside analogue prodrug (ProTide), was repurposed. In May 2020, it received emergency approval by the FDA, being the first drug approved to fight the new coronavirus (COVID-19) disease which targets the virus directly. The main synthetic strategies toward Remdesivir, and their relevant modifications, are presented and discussed, to provide a panoramic view of the state-of-the-art and the more important advances in this field. Recent progress, proposed improvements, and uses of novel technologies for the synthetic sequence are also detailed.
